It will take the motor 39.2 seconds to lift the piano to the sixth-story window.

<u>Given the following data;</u>

  • Power = 1500 Watts
  • Mass = 300 kg
  • Height = 20 meters

We know that acceleration due to gravity is equal to 9.8 m/s².

To find how long it will take to lift the piano to the sixth-story window;

First of all, we would have to determine the gravitational potential energy required to lift the piano up.

Mathematically, gravitational potential energy is given by the formula;

G.P.E = mgh

where:

G.P.E is the  gravitational potential energy of an object.

m is the mass of the object.

g is the acceleration due to gravity.

h is the height of the object.

Substituting into the formula, we have;

G.P.E = 300*9.8*20

G.P.E = 58,800 Joules

Next, we would determine the time using the following formula;

Time = \frac{Energy}{Time}

Substituting the values into the formula, we have;

Time = \frac{58800}{1500}

<em>Time = 39.2 seconds.</em>
